Summary
Epidemiological surveillance is one of the eight core components of the World Health Organization Infection Prevention and Control Programmes. These include surveillance programmes for surgical site infection (SSI). At present, for SSI surveillance, infection control teams perform a manual time-consuming work, which could make a transition to automated surveillance leveraging the new information technology. The aim of this study was to evaluate the performance of a novel algorithm to detect SSI in a cohort of elective colorectal surgery patients who have been previously screened within a nationwide healthcare-associated infection surveillance system.
